The minimum level of gravity can be felt in the ocean near Sri Lanka: this anomaly has been known for a long time, but it was possible to explain it only now, by the influence of the African mantle province and the Indian subcontinent, which is rapidly escaping from it.

On images from space, our Earth looks almost perfectly round, but much is hidden by the water that covers most of its surface. In fact, the planet is full of irregularities, mountain ranges and deep depressions, covered with thick continental tectonic plates, and sometimes with much thinner oceanic plates.

All this creates an uneven distribution of mass in the Earth's lithosphere, and if it were covered with water, would not rotate, if there were no currents or waves in the ocean, then the thickness of the water layer in different regions would be different, and the maximum difference between the highest and in low parts it would approach 200 m. This conditional "sea level" forms the shape of a geoid, which gives a more accurate idea of the shape of our planet than an ideal sphere visible from near-earth orbit.

One of the most notable details will be the Indian Ocean Geoid Low (IOGL), with its deepest point at –106 m, located south of Sri Lanka. Explaining the mass deficit that creates this anomaly remains one of the most interesting problems in modern geophysics. Now, however, it seems to have been solved - through the efforts of Attreyee Ghosh and his colleagues at the Indian Institute of Sciences in Bangalore, as well as from Germany. The article of scientists is published by the journal Geophysical Research Letters, briefly about their work tells the message of the American Geophysical Union (AGU).

Geophysicists have modeled convective currents in the Earth's mantle - powerful currents in which hotter and lighter material rises to the surface, while dense and colder material descends. At the same time, the IOGL anomaly was associated with an excess of a less dense and light substance. But where does it come from? As a rule, such areas are associated with the action of mantle plumes, rising hot streams. However, field observations do not find anything suitable nearby.

On the other hand, the African superplume is located a little further to the west. Scientists have shown that India, rather quickly moving away from Africa, directs part of the mantle flows from this vast province to the east. They reach just the center of the anomaly in the Indian Ocean; it looks like the mystery of the largest gravity anomaly has been solved.
